  2. 21 April 2026

    Answer

    The funding breakdown is as follows:Autumn Budget 2024: £120 million for zero emission vehicle uptake and £200 million for charging infrastructure.Spending Review 2025: £1.4 billion for zero emission vehicle uptake and £400 million for charging infrastruc...
